A temporary Instagram account lock denotes a security measure implemented by the platform to safeguard user accounts from unauthorized access or suspicious activity. This action restricts account functionality for a defined period, preventing posting, liking, commenting, or messaging. This lock commonly arises when Instagram detects activities such as rapid following/unfollowing, automated commenting, or logging in from unfamiliar locations, all of which could suggest bot activity or a compromised account.
The implementation of temporary locks serves as a crucial defense mechanism against spam, phishing attempts, and account breaches. Its existence promotes a safer user experience, deterring malicious actors and protecting the integrity of the platform’s community. Historically, as social media platforms grew, the need for proactive security measures like temporary locks became paramount due to the increased vulnerability of accounts to hacking and misuse. These measures evolved alongside the growing sophistication of cyber threats.
